Daily Duties and Responsibilities
As a Sleep Coordinator at our dental office, you will play a crucial role in assisting patients with sleep disorders by coordinating their care and ensuring they receive the necessary diagnostic tests and treatments. You will work closely with physicians, patients, and other healthcare providers to streamline the sleep disorder management process and improve patient outcomes.
**Responsibilities:**
1. **Patient Coordination:**
- Schedule appointments for initial consultations, diagnostic tests (such as polysomnography), and follow-up visits related to sleep disorders.
- Coordinate with insurance providers to obtain necessary authorizations for sleep studies and treatments.
- Educate patients about sleep disorders, diagnostic procedures, and treatment options.
2. **Administrative Duties:**
- Maintain accurate patient records and ensure all documentation is complete.
- Manage patient inquiries regarding appointments, test results, and treatment plans.
- Collaborate with medical billing staff to ensure accurate billing and coding related to sleep disorder services.
3. **Collaboration:**
- Communicate effectively with physicians, sleep technologists, and other healthcare professionals to ensure coordinated patient care.
- Assist in scheduling interdisciplinary meetings to discuss complex cases and treatment plans.
- Facilitate referrals to specialists or other healthcare providers as needed.
4. **Patient Support:**
- Provide ongoing support and guidance to patients throughout their treatment journey.
- Monitor patient progress and compliance with prescribed treatments.
- Address patient concerns or questions regarding their sleep disorder management.
5. **Quality Assurance:**
- Participate in quality improvement initiatives related to sleep disorder services.
- Ensure adherence to established protocols and guidelines for sleep disorder diagnosis and treatment.
- Contribute to the development and implementation of patient education materials and resources.
